Understanding Custom Belt Buckles Wholesale
Ordering custom belt buckles wholesale means buying a larger quantity of buckles—often at least 20 to 50—at once, rather than purchasing individually. Wholesale orders offer:
- Lower per-unit pricing,
- Custom design options tailored to you,
- Potential for branding with your logo or unique artwork,
- Efficient options for team gear, resale, or promotional events.
Custom wholesalers, from large-scale manufacturers to artisan shops, make the process accessible for buyers with a vision.
Step-by-Step: How to Order Custom Belt Buckles Wholesale
Here are simple steps to follow for sourcing wholesale, one-of-a-kind belt buckles:
1. Define Your Needs and Goals
Before reaching out to a manufacturer or supplier, ask yourself:
- What is the purpose for these buckles? (Team, business, event, retail)
- What quantity do you need? (Most wholesalers have minimums)
- Do you already have a specific design in mind?
- What is your target budget?
The clearer your vision, the easier the process will be.
2. Choose Your Material and Style
Belt buckles come in a range of materials and finishes, each affecting price, weight, and appearance. Common options include:
- Zinc alloy (durable, versatile, and popular for custom designs)
- Brass (classic western look)
- Stainless steel (modern, rust-resistant)
- Aluminum (lightweight, cost-effective)
- Enamel, paint, or inlays for color and detail
Styles range from traditional western buckles, minimalist designs, bottle openers, to custom shapes. Decide if you want:
- Full-color, engraved, or 3D design elements
- Polished, antiqued, or matte finishes
3. Decide on Customization Details
Customization brings your vision to life:
- Logos or branding
- Names, dates, messages, or slogans
- Shapes (oval, rectangular, custom silhouettes)
- Size (small, standard, or oversized)
- Attachment mechanism (traditional tongue, snap, or slide-style)
Sketch or describe your design—or work with a designer provided by your supplier.
4. Research and Connect with a Supplier
Look for established wholesale belt buckle manufacturers who:
- Offer proven quality (browse their design galleries!)
- Have experience in bulk custom orders
- Provide clear pricing, minimum orders, and samples
Suppliers often specialize—for example: artisan handmade (great for awards), laser-engraved styles, or promotional bulk buckles.
5. Request a Quote and Design Proof
Reach out with your requirements—quantity, design, material, and timeline. The typical process:
- Supplier reviews your needs.
- You receive a quote based on your specs.
- A digital proof/mockup is created for your approval.
- Some suppliers offer sample buckles for an extra fee, which can be credited back if you proceed.
6. Place Your Order
Once you approve the design and costs, you’ll:
- Submit a purchase order and/or pay a deposit.
- Confirm production timeline and shipping details.
- Many wholesalers can also arrange custom packaging if needed.
7. Review and Receive Your Buckles
Production takes from 2 to 8 weeks, depending on complexity and order size. Once your buckles arrive:
- Check for quality and consistency.
- Ensure the customization matches your approved proof.

Potential Challenges and How to Overcome Them
Every project has hurdles. Here’s what to watch out for when ordering custom buckles in bulk:
- Minimum Order Quantities: Most manufacturers will require a minimum order of 20, 50, or even 100 pieces.
- Design Complexity: Intricate artwork can increase costs or extend production times.
- Shipping Costs and Times: Bulk orders are heavy and may affect international shipping rates and speed.
- Communication: Misunderstandings in design or specifications can lead to errors.
Tip: Always request a sample or physical proof, if timeline allows, before full production.

Cost-Saving Tips and Shipping Insights
When buying custom belt buckles wholesale, costs include more than just the product price:
- Order Larger Quantities: Price-per-buckle often drops at higher volumes.
- Choose Local or Regional Suppliers: Reduce shipping times and rates, and it’s easier to resolve issues.
- Consolidate Shipments: Ordering all at once is usually cheaper than separate batches.
- Explore Bulk Shipping Discounts: Some suppliers offer flat-rate shipping or will arrange freight for large orders.
- Watch Out for Hidden Fees: Clarify if die charges, samples, or rush fees are included in your quote.
For international buyers, be sure to ask about:
- Customs duties and taxes
- Tracking options
- Estimated delivery timelines
Factory vs. Handcrafted: Which to Choose?
Some suppliers offer mass-produced, cast, or stamped buckles, which are perfect for cost-effective bulk orders. Others, such as artisan studios, craft buckles by hand, ideal for luxury, awards, or low-volume exclusive runs.
Consider your audience and purpose—sometimes, a mix of both makes sense.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
How many custom belt buckles do I have to order for wholesale pricing?
Most manufacturers set their minimum order between 20 and 50 pieces. The more you order, the lower the price per buckle.
What is the usual lead time for custom wholesale orders?
Lead times range from 2 to 8 weeks. Complex designs, high volumes, or international shipping may add extra time.
Can I order a sample before committing to the full order?
Yes, most reputable suppliers provide a physical or digital proof. Physical samples may come at an extra charge, often credited to your final order.
What if I don’t have a finalized design? Can the manufacturer help?
Absolutely! Many wholesale buckle makers offer in-house design assistance. Providing a sketch or description is a great starting point.
Are there extra costs for custom designs, dies, or set-up?
Some suppliers include set-up or die fees in your quote, while others list them separately. Always clarify what’s included to avoid surprises in your invoice.
